    About Us

    Making the Impossible Possible, Inc. (MIPO, Inc.) is a 501c3 organization dedicated to promoting the quality of life of immigrant youth and their families residing in the New York metropolitan area through a variety of activities. MIPO, Inc., located in Brooklyn, New York, provides support, such as life’s skills and a path forward for underprivileged youth and their families. Projects range from organizing youth summits, awarding scholarships to high school graduating seniors in the NY metro-area to financial wellness presentations and ESL classes to non English speakers. Additionally, we support schools in Haiti with short- and long-term projects, and conducting professional development training for educators in Haiti. Through our intensive training program, our Teacher Leaders have the task of training other educators to use research-based techniques and methods learned from the expertise of MIPO’s team which in return will influence student achievement.
